Quick report

While the sunny day was nice, I still observed an unintentionally triggered persistent slab avalanche that broke up to 2 ft deep on a layer of buried surface hoar on the 2/13 interface (HS-AMu-R2-D2-O / NE, 6700'). According to nearby groups, this avalanche broke the day prior on 2/28. Other obvious signs of instability felt minimal, though. Digging down told more of the story and revealed a layer of buried surface hoar and rounding facets above the 2/7 crust that would consistently show the ability to propagate with PSTs. This weak layer was also the likely culprit of this triggered avalanche. 

With the mild temperatures and clear skies, wet snow did materialize on sun-exposed SE-W aspects. I did observe a couple of large wet loose in the Goat Rocks Wilderness, but there were no observed wet loose in the immediate Darland Mountain area.

Snowpack

You can still launch from the Ahtanum Meadows Sno-Park, just barely. There are a few dry sections you'll need to navigate, but continuous snow coverage is present within a mile. 

The 2/13 and 2/7 crust interface sit about 50-60 cm below the surface in this area. The 2/13 consists of 3-5 mm buried surface hoar with some faceted grains just beneath it. PSTs propagated through the whole columns with cut lengths averaging 30-40 cm/100 End. CT's would produce sudden collapse on these same layers with ECTs providing unremarkable test results.
